About Andrea

I am university researcher and teacher in Philosophy, and certified Associate Fellow of the Higher Education. During the last six years I have taught at the University of Rome, at the University of Nottingham, and at the University of Exeter. My university teaching expertise is primarily in ancient philosophy, metaphysics, philosophy of mind, epistemology, ethics, history of philosophy, and philosophy of science. I have a long-standing experience in preparing students for their A-level/OCR/IB (Philosophy and Ethics, Religious Studies, Mind and God) and I have been awarded the "“Best Teacher Prize" at the University of Exeter for having provided “outstanding teaching and support to undergraduate students”. The primary aim of my teaching is to enable students to think clearly and for themselves, and I am passionate about helping young minds achieving their potential and building confidence in their capacities.

As a professional academic teacher, my sessions are highly structured and well tested. Yet, tailoring the course to students learning requirements and goals is always the first step in any pedagogical processes. The first session focuses on understanding which goals the student aims to achieve, her background and methodological starting capabilities. This first session is key to the success of the personal tutoring.


Each session is centered on clear and actionable Individual Learning Objectives (ILOs), anticipated before the session together with the suggested reading list. The session divides into three parts. The first is verifies and strengthen understanding of the material. The second develops and improve the critical abilities of the student through high-quality discussion and questioning. Finally, the third focuses on academic and pre-academic writing skills, an essential capability that each student needs to master. Overall, each teaching session aims to offer complete training that allows students to build their knowledge and confidence steadily, progressively and efficiently.


At the end of each session, ILOs are summarized, understanding of the student verified, and the objectives for the successive sessions introduced. Every two weeks I evaluate student's progress, asking to write a small essay concerning topics discussed previously, and discuss strengths and weakness of the work.
